Yugoslavian vs Panamanian Single Father Poverty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 233,019,111 people shows no correlation between the proportion of Yugoslavians and poverty level among single fathers in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.040 and weighted average of 16.3%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 236,933,167 people shows a weak positive correlation between the proportion of Panamanians and poverty level among single fathers in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.293 and weighted average of 16.4%, a difference of 0.93%.
